Transaction 88456cdb76143594052e23debd89b9dff19c95182f2d53ef2d6825533728f111

1 Input
2 Outputs
  • 88456cdb76143594052e23debd89b9dff19c95182f2d53ef2d6825533728f111:0
  • value  39769290
    address  1M2zpQVpCsbEsQ4Z7Yah2QMW6GcPLmp9aL
  • 88456cdb76143594052e23debd89b9dff19c95182f2d53ef2d6825533728f111:1
  • value  230000
    address  3JuYCtwukk3z4QWC12MkEKXjB5pfyfXcBt